# Creating a Jump for a Real Time Journey With a real-time journey jump, you can send profiles to the destination journey stage based on their behaviors during the journey. ![](/assets/rtjump.233a8bbcfabdb8bb22301a61f1ce4b23c2edc34253a6f40f61d2fc33a01ce224.9e7171ae.png) ## Limitations * You cannot jump to a previous stage in the current journey. * Circulating jumps is not supported. For example, you can jump from Journey A to Journey B and then back to Journey A. * A journey can support a maximum of 20 jumps. ## Create a Jump When you add a jump event to your journey, the jump becomes the final condition because you cannot follow a jump with any other event. You can add multiple jumps within the same journey stage by adding jumps to different decision point paths and multiple jump events to the different journey stages. 1. Open TD Console. 2. Navigate to Audience Studio. 3. Open an existing journey or [create a journey](/products/customer-data-platform/journey-orchestration/batch/creating-a-batch-journey). 4. Drag the jump event to your journey workflow. The following jump destinations are supported: * A different stage in the same journey * A stage in a different journey [draft or launched](/products/customer-data-platform/journey-orchestration/batch/understanding-journey-statuses) * When the journey meets its goal * After meeting the exit criteria * If you add a jump to a stage in a different journey, you must have full access permission for the different journey. If you don't have full access permission, you cannot select the journey. * You cannot add or remove a jump after launching a journey. * The jump profile doesn't have to fulfill the entry criteria of the destination journey stage. 1. Name your jump event. 2. Select the profiles that will move to the designated jump destination: * (Optional) Filter for draft or launched journeys. * (Required) Select the stage in the same journey or a different journey. 1. Select **Save jump**. ## Examples * [Journey Type Filter](/products/customer-data-platform/journey-orchestration/realtime/creating-a-jump-for-a-real-time-journey#journey-type-filter) * [Same Journey Jump](/products/customer-data-platform/journey-orchestration/realtime/creating-a-jump-for-a-real-time-journey#same-journey-jump) * [Different Journey Jump](/products/customer-data-platform/journey-orchestration/realtime/creating-a-jump-for-a-real-time-journey#different-journey-jump) * [Goal Journey Jump](/products/customer-data-platform/journey-orchestration/realtime/creating-a-jump-for-a-real-time-journey#goal-journey-jump) * [Exit Criteria Jump](/products/customer-data-platform/journey-orchestration/realtime/creating-a-jump-for-a-real-time-journey#exit-criteria-jump) ### Journey Type Filter ![](/assets/image2023-3-22_16-1-19.fd3934962e78746aa39b2a211f70b4dda38ef52a93d08c6349b97cadc1ee8fe4.9e7171ae.png) ### Same Journey Jump ![](/assets/image2023-3-24_13-5-26.2cada61e9b0b92b54c8e9cf110b382f6d8dc713f2a6f22310372fcd66f321d99.9e7171ae.png) ### Different Journey Jump ![](/assets/image2023-3-24_14-28-19.b296df412720bd9c686d2e49d5afb1fc46a3f17d5a6cb1c773c741160586320b.9e7171ae.png) ### Goal Journey Jump ![](/assets/image2023-3-28_14-31-7.6ed1f09802714ac2b14e3d8f860b83c9a932c1094c06013ed8c75deeb62004c0.9e7171ae.png) ### Exit Criteria Jump You can include a jump for custom exit criteria as well as a stale profile. ![](/assets/image2023-3-28_14-46-4.a1130920cf77801040299bb343a9fcc8921892f2fed1c40554adcec9c1daaf91.9e7171ae.png) # Understand the Move Profiles File Path In the following example, the file path first lists the stage name, journey, and folder names. ![](/assets/image2023-3-24_14-31-53.0d4f4a18f7913d120920460086f9d8ac0ecab1d2ecc0a32d6de3ab36222b89cd.9e7171ae.png) # Jump Edge Cases The following edge cases describe behaviors you might not expect or anticipate when creating a jump. ## Duplicated Profiles in Target Journey There might be an instance where the same profile exists in the original and targeted journeys for the jump. ![](/assets/image2023-3-27_10-51-32.246bbd5001b59bb19b6b94d9c76a8079622e32d274ad49ee551faeafd73d25b0.9e7171ae.png) Profile A meets the *qual_cust* journey's *Awareness* stage criteria in the previous example. The jump's target is to the journey *onboard* , stage *Enroll*. However, Profile A is already in *SMS* of the target journey. The state of Profile A in the *onboard* journey is not reset; because the profile is already in SMS, the profiles remain in SMS. Jump from Multiple Journeys In the following example, Profile A qualifies for a jump to the journey stage *In cart* in journey *purchase*. Profile A also qualifies for a jump to the journey stage. *Confirm* in journey *purchase*. ![](/assets/image2023-3-27_15-39-43.eea4641f3bc4d750fa69ecda38e9d45b579e6a10c7d833e0b5c31fb97f95c2a9.9e7171ae.png) Treasure Data Journey Orchestration rules dictate that if multiple destinations are in the same journey for a single profile, the profile should jump to the "lowest" stage. See also [Journey FAQs](/products/customer-data-platform/journey-orchestration/batch/journey-faqs).